Beyond superscalar using FPGAs

A superscalar processor with three execution units is described in details in this paper. The execution units are implemented using reprogrammable field-programmable gate array (FPGA) chips, allowing the user to configure them to best fit the application. Each instruction, composed of 128 bits, directly controls all the processor resources, in a horizontal microprogramming way
